WebTwo nitrogen atoms enter the urea cycle as NH 4+ and aspartate. The first steps of the cycle take place in liver mitochondria, where NH 4+ combines with HCO 3- to form carbamoyl phosphate. The small number after the element symbol is called the subscript … WebMar 4, 2024 · Explanation: In an ammonium ion (N H + 4) ion, there is one nitrogen atom and four hydrogen atoms. Nitrogen has an atomic number of 7, and hydrogen has an atomic number of 1, and so the total atomic number of the hydrogens will be 1 ⋅ 4 = 4. So, there will be a total of 7 + 4 = 11 protons.
